Release v3.4

🎉 What's New

Better-Looking Dense Graphs

The repulsion force was rebuilt around one idea: handle far and near neighbors differently.

  • Far away — a stack of grids, coarse for distant points and finer closer in. A distant group counts as one blob at its average position, and every part of space is counted exactly once: no gaps, no double counting, nothing to tune.
  • Up close — real point-to-point forces instead of an average. From each nearby grid cell a point takes up to 8 actual neighbors, picked at random and re-picked every tick, weighted so it averages out to the exact answer as the layout settles. Cells holding 8 points or fewer use all of them, so most graphs get exact close-range forces.
  • Stacked points — points sitting at exactly the same spot have no direction to separate along, so each is pushed along its own random direction and the pile comes apart instead of staying stuck.

Dense hubs spread into readable clouds and tight clusters open up. It's also faster per simulation step. How it works in detail →

simulationRepulsionTheta no longer does anything — the new algorithm has no distance bands to tune. It's still accepted so existing configs keep working, but you can safely delete it.

Smoother Hover on Large Graphs

The GPU now keeps extra, off-screen images of the graph in which every pixel records which point — or which link — covers it. Hovering is then a quick lookup: read the pixels right under the cursor, instead of checking every point in the graph.

The point image is drawn smaller than the screen — half resolution, and capped on very large displays. Hover doesn't need pixel-perfect precision, and at full size the image would cost tens of megabytes of GPU memory. Links keep full resolution, because a thin link would otherwise fall between pixels and become hard to hover. Both images are redrawn only when the scene changes, and hover reads them without making anything wait.

Hover does nothing at all while the scene and the cursor are both still, and picking is forgiving: you don't have to hit a point dead-center.

Faster Rendering When Points Overlap

When opaque points overlap, only the one on top is visible. The opaque middles are now drawn first, starting with the topmost point, so the GPU can skip whatever is buried underneath instead of drawing it and painting over it. Soft edges and see-through points follow in a second pass, so the picture looks exactly the same — while heavily overlapping scenes render faster.

It's on by default, and applies while points are fully opaque and highlighting isn't in use — otherwise rendering falls back to the old single pass on its own. Set pointOcclusionCulling: false to switch it off entirely. Live demo: Misc → Point Occlusion Culling.

On-Demand Rendering

Frames are drawn only when something changes, and rendering stops completely when your graph is idle — no GPU, CPU, or battery spent on a static scene. Interactions, config changes, and data updates all wake rendering automatically.

Updates js-yaml from 4.2.0 to 5.3.0

Changelog

Sourced from js-yaml's changelog.

[5.3.0] - 2026-08-14

This release focuses on reworking the documentation and making small architectural improvements before moving forward.

Added

  • Added completely new documentation.
  • Exported DUMP_SCHEMA, the default schema used by the dumper.
  • Added YAMLException.throwAt() for throwing an error at a source position.

Changed

  • Changed flat constant exports to grouped exports: EVENT_ID, SCALAR_STYLE, COLLECTION_STYLE, and CHOMPING_MODE, along with their value types. The old exports are still preserved, but deprecated.
  • Made identify mandatory for custom tag definitions. Use identify: () => false for load-only tags.

Deprecated

  • Deprecated flat constant exports. Use grouped ones instead.

Removed

  • Removed the MERGE_KEY export (not used anymore after last fixes).

Fixed

  • Validate << sequence items at merge time, so aliased merge sources are checked too.
  • Resolve << outside of a mapping key as the plain string '<<', matching v4, instead of leaking an internal symbol into the result.

[5.2.3] - 2026-08-01

Fixed

  • Prevent prototype fallback when resolving tags and mapping entries, #782.
  • Resolve !!timestamp years 0000-0099 correctly, #775.
  • Preserve implicit null mapping values before document markers and reject unpaired mapping event streams, #784.
  • Preserve folded scalar values with tab-indented lines when round-tripping a parsed AST through present(); dump() and loading are unaffected, #780.

[5.2.2] - 2026-07-24

Fixed

  • Quote flow scalars where a colon precedes a flow indicator, #773.

Security

  • Avoid exponential parsing time for nested flow sequence pairs.

Changelog

Sourced from monaco-editor's changelog.

[0.56.0]

Breaking Changes

  • Reorganizes the exported ESM modules to provide supported, tree-shakeable entry points (#5155). The monaco-editor entry point continues to load all features and languages. Custom bundles can now import monaco-editor/editor and opt into:
    • all editor features with monaco-editor/features/register.all, or individual features with monaco-editor/features/<feature>/register;
    • all language definitions with monaco-editor/languages/definitions/register.all, or individual definitions with monaco-editor/languages/definitions/<language>/register;
    • the CSS, HTML, JSON, and TypeScript language features with monaco-editor/languages/features/register.all, or their individual register entry points.
  • Renames the misspelled IOverlayWidgetPosition.stackOridinal property to stackOrdinal.
  • Removes the deprecated IMirrorModel and IWorkerContext worker API types.

New Features and APIs

  • Adds editor.doubleClickSelectsBlock.
  • Adds editor.find.closeOnResult and editor.inlayHints.showLongLineWarning.
  • Adds offWhenInlineCompletions to QuickSuggestionsValue.
  • Adds model and provider option support to inline completion providers.
  • Adds ICodeEditor.revealAllCursors, ICodeEditor.getWidthOfLine, and ICodeEditor.renderAsync.
  • Adds advanced-external and advanced-wasm diff algorithms.
  • Exposes typed native LSP client and transport APIs.

Fixes

  • Treats Markdown returned by language servers as untrusted (#5280).
  • Updates the editor core to the version used by 0.56.0-dev-20260625.

[0.55.1]

  • Fixes missing language exports (monaco.json/typescript/...) due to wrong "types" path - #5123

[0.55.0]

Breaking Changes

  • Moves nested namespaces (languages.css, languages.html, languages.json, languages.typescript) to top level namespaces (css, html, json, typescript) to simplify the build process and align with typescript recommendations.

New Features

  • Adds native LSP support (see new lsp namespace).

Bug Fixes

  • Updates dompurify to 3.2.7

[0.54.0]

  • Adds option editor.mouseMiddleClickAction
  • Various bug fixes

[0.53.0]

  • ⚠️ This release deprecates the AMD build and ships with significant changes of the AMD build. The AMD build will still be shipped for a while, but we don't offer support for it anymore. Please migrate to the ESM build.
